A simple npm package that detects characteristics of spaghetti code by analyzing JavaScript code snippets. It checks for deep nesting and long functions, giving you insights into your code's structure.

function isSpaghettiCode(code) { // Check for deep nesting const lines = code.split('\n'); let nestingLevel = 0; let maxNestingLevel = 0; for (const line of lines) { if (line.includes('{')) nestingLevel++; if (line.includes('}')) nestingLevel--; maxNestingLevel = Math.max(maxNestingLevel, nestingLevel); } // Check for long functions const longFunctionThreshold = 20; // Example threshold for lines in a function const functionLines = lines.filter(line => line.includes('function')); const longFunctions = functionLines.filter(line => { const startIndex = lines.indexOf(line); let count = 0; for (let i = startIndex; i < lines.length; i++) { count++; if (lines[i].includes('}')) break; } return count > longFunctionThreshold; }); return { isSpaghetti: maxNestingLevel > 3 || longFunctions.length > 0, maxNestingLevel, longFunctionCount: longFunctions.length, }; } module.exports = isSpaghettiCode;
